Let's think about Salsa dance and music as a large Tree that appears like this: Salsa is danced worldwide while lots of technical aspects of the dance coincide throughout styles (6 steps over 8 beats danced on a quick-quick-slow or slow-quick-quick rhythm), there are numerous "hallmark" attributes of the major styles of Salsa that differentiate one from the various other.Couples participating in a Casino site Rueda dance all actions in unison as called by a Leader. Distinct features of Cuban design salsa are round turn patterns (with "break back" actions on matters 1 and 5) in addition to body movement influenced by conventional Afro-Cuban folkloric dances. Distinct features of Cali design salsa is quick and detailed footwork, danced with a solid hand hold connection in between companions.
The beginnings of the style are a subject of dispute, but it is stated that New York style Salsa dance stemmed in the 1960's due to the increase of Latin American emigrants after the Cuban Transformation (salsa dancing sf). Eddie Torres is the most well recognized New york city style dancer, being nearly widely credited with promoting the style to dance centres outside of New York

Despite which style you choose it is very important to stay with that style until you're really comfy with the basics of timing, body rhythm and foundation move implementation prior to taking into consideration "changing" styles (if you intend to)
As soon as you begin on lessons prepare to devote energy and time to finding out exactly how to dance in general it takes a full novice (i. e., somebody with little or no dancing experience) concerning 6 months of actively taking lessons and heading out and practicing at the very least two times a week to reach a factor where pattern execution starts to really feel "natural".
